动植物检疫系(生物工程系)-刘哲

发布者:白巍发布时间:2020-12-25浏览次数:1422

    刘哲1978年,2016年毕业于黑龙江八一农垦大学,农学博士学位副教授/硕士研究生,黑龙江省细胞生物学学会成员。先后主持省部级教学及科研项目2项,横向科研项目1黑龙江八一农垦大学大学生创新创业训练计划项目1项。发表论文20余篇,其中SCI收录论文6篇。出版专著2部。主要从事微量元素、动物免疫和药理细胞毒理检测的研究,在学术上取得了一定成绩。主要承担细胞工程等本科生课程的教学任务。
